Keeping Your Modules Independent
================================

One of the goals of using modules is to create discrete units of functionality
that do not have many (if any) dependencies, allowing you to use that
functionality in other applications without including unnecessary items.

Doctrine MongoDB ODM includes a utility called
``ResolveTargetDocumentListener``, that functions by intercepting certain calls
inside Doctrine and rewriting ``targetDocument`` parameters in your metadata
mapping at runtime. This allows your bundle to use an interface or abstract
class in its mappings while still allowing the mapping to resolve to a concrete
document class at runtime. It will also rewrite class names when no mapping
metadata has been found for the original class name.

This functionality allows you to define relationships between different
documents without creating hard dependencies.
If you work with independent modules, you may encounter the problem of creating
relationships between objects in different modules. This is problematic because
it creates a dependency between the modules. This can be resolved by using
interfaces or abstract classes to define the relationships between the objects
and then using the ``ResolveTargetDocumentListener``. This event listener will
intercept certain calls inside Doctrine and rewrite ``targetDocument``
parameters in your metadata mapping at runtime. It will also rewrite class names
when no mapping metadata has been found for the original class name.

With this configuration, you can create an ``Invoice`` document and set the
``subject`` property to a ``Customer`` document. When the invoice is retrieved
from the database, the ``subject`` property will be an instance of
``Customer``.

.. code-block:: php
<?php
use Acme\InvoiceModule\Document\Invoice;
use App\Document\Customer;
$customer = new Customer();
$customer->name = 'Example Customer';
$invoice = new Invoice();
$invoice->subject = $customer;
$dm->persist($customer);
$dm->persist($invoice);
$dm->flush();
$dm->clear();
// Retrieve the invoice from the database
$invoice = $dm->find(Invoice::class, $invoice->id);
// The subject property will be an instance of Customer
echo $invoice->subject->getName();
